 +  * [[http://maps.ozultimate.com/archive/08_print|Print]] - basic topo map only, but enables a user selectable box to select a print area. When the save button is clicked, the tiles are downloaded and stitched together, and a PNG file exported. The resulting image usually needs some post-processing, as the contour lines print in a pale colour.
